TheJournal of Contemporary Health Law and Policy is alaw review run by students at theColumbus School of Law (The Catholic University of America, Washington, D.C.). It was established in 1985 byGeorge P. Smith II and is published semi-annually. The journal covers health-related issues, including legal analysis of recent trends in modernhealth care, issues involving the relationship of thelife sciences to thesocial sciences andhumanities,bioethics, and ethical, economic, philosophical and social aspects of medical practice and the delivery of health care systems.
TheJournal of Contemporary Health Law and Policy is abstracted and indexed inIndex of Legal Periodicals,LexisNexis,Westlaw,Current Index to Legal Periodicals,Current Law Index,BIOSIS,MEDLINE, andCurrent Contents/Health Services Administration.
The journal organizes an annual symposium at the Columbus School of Law on current issues in the health and legal fields.
